MebleinUK has dated this Edwardian Mahogany Single Bed to the Edwardian era.

The warm mahogany has developed a rich colour and attractive patina, giving the bed considerable period character. The elegant proportions and restrained decoration are typical of the Edwardian period, when furniture became lighter and more refined than many Victorian designs.

Both the headboard and footboard stand on their original-style castors, while the bed is joined by sturdy metal side rails.
A particularly attractive antique bed which would work beautifully in a traditional bedroom, guest room, cottage or period property.

Dimensions
Overall length: 201 cm
Overall width: 106 cm
Headboard height: 122 cm
Footboard height: 84 cm
Suitable mattress length: approximately 190 cm
Mattress size: approximately 90 × 190 cm / UK Single
The frame is in very good antique condition, solid and sturdy, with age-related marks, small scratches and variations in colour consistent with its age and previous use. Please study the photographs as they form part of the description.
